Product Description: Used primarily in the synthesis of pharmaceuticals, particularly in the development of drugs targeting neurological disorders. It serves as a key intermediate in the production of compounds that exhibit antipsychotic and antidepressant properties. Additionally, it is utilized in the manufacture of organic light-emitting diodes (OLEDs) due to its ability to enhance the efficiency and stability of these devices. In the field of agriculture, it is employed in the formulation of certain pesticides that protect crops from fungal infections. Its role in chemical research includes being a precursor for various heterocyclic compounds, which are essential in creating new materials with potential industrial applications.
